Exploring the Language of Fear and Its Historical Roots
This chapter explores the intricacies of language rules regarding sentence structure while examining the historical journey of the word 'fear' from its Anglo-Saxon origins. It also discusses how cultural differences shape the understanding and expression of emotions, highlighting variations in the perception of fear across societies.
